400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el107兆为什么这么大

作者:路由通
|
232人看过
发布时间:2026-04-26 09:25:11
标签:
一个107兆字节的电子表格文件,其庞大的体积往往令用户感到困惑。本文将深入剖析其背后成因,从基础数据结构到高级功能应用,系统解析导致文件异常增大的十二个关键因素。我们将探讨格式选择、冗余数据、公式计算、对象嵌入以及版本差异等多个层面,并提供切实可行的优化与瘦身策略,帮助您有效管理文件大小,提升工作效率。
excel107兆为什么这么大

       在日常办公中,我们偶尔会遇到一个令人咋舌的情况:一个看似普通的电子表格文件,其体积竟然高达107兆字节,甚至更大。面对如此庞大的文件,打开缓慢、编辑卡顿、传输困难等问题接踵而至,不禁让人疑惑:它为什么会变得这么大?这背后并非单一原因所致,而是多种因素共同作用的结果。理解这些成因,是有效管理和优化文件的第一步。

       本文将为您抽丝剥茧,逐一揭示导致电子表格文件体积异常庞大的核心因素,并提供相应的诊断思路与解决方案。无论您是数据分析师、财务人员还是普通办公者,掌握这些知识都将有助于您更好地驾驭这一强大的工具。

一、 文件格式的先天差异

       首先需要明确的是,文件格式是决定其基础大小的关键。微软的电子表格程序主要使用两种扩展名格式:传统的“XLS”格式和基于可扩展标记语言的“XLSX”格式。后者作为2007年及以后版本引入的默认格式,采用了开放标准的压缩技术,能够将工作簿中的组件(如工作表、公式、格式)以独立的可扩展标记语言文件形式存储在一个压缩包内。因此,在内容完全相同的情况下,一个保存为“XLSX”格式的文件,其体积通常会比保存为旧版“XLS”格式的文件小得多。如果您手中的107兆文件恰好是“XLS”格式,那么尝试将其另存为“XLSX”格式,很可能就会实现一次显著的“瘦身”。

二、 工作表的数量与范围

       工作簿中工作表的数量及其实际使用范围,是影响文件大小的直接因素。每一个新增的工作表,即便其中只填写了几个单元格,系统也会为其分配一定的存储空间来记录结构信息。更常见的问题是“幽灵区域”——即那些看似空白,实则被格式化或包含不可见字符的单元格区域。例如,用户可能无意中在很远的位置(如第100万行)设置过格式或输入过数据后又删除,导致程序仍然认为这些区域是“已使用”的。您可以通过按下“Ctrl + End”组合键来定位当前工作表的最后一个被使用的单元格,如果这个位置远超出您的实际数据区域,就说明存在大量无效的占用空间。

三、 单元格格式的过度应用

       丰富的单元格格式(如字体、颜色、边框、条件格式、数字格式)能让表格美观清晰,但过度或大范围的格式应用会显著增加文件体积。特别是当您对整列或整行应用了复杂的条件格式规则、自定义数字格式或单元格样式时,这些信息都需要被存储下来。一个常见的误区是选中整个工作表列或行来设置格式,而不是仅针对有数据的区域。检查并清除那些实际数据区域之外的单元格格式,是缩小文件的有效方法。

四、 公式的复杂性与海量引用

       公式是电子表格的灵魂,也是导致文件膨胀的“大户”。首先,公式本身需要存储。一个引用其他工作表或工作簿的复杂数组公式,其文本内容可能就很长。其次,更重要的是公式的计算链和依赖关系。大量公式(尤其是易失性函数,如“今天”、“现在”、“随机数”、“间接引用”等)会导致每次打开文件或进行更改时都需要重新计算,这不仅占用计算资源,其关联的缓存信息也会增加文件负担。此外,引用整个列(如“A:A”)的公式,虽然写起来方便,但会让程序处理海量潜在的计算引用,即使很多单元格是空的。

五、 数据透视表的缓存与细节

       数据透视表是强大的数据分析工具,但它会为源数据创建一个独立的缓存副本。这个缓存包含了用于快速聚合和筛选的所有数据。当您的源数据量非常庞大(例如数十万行),并且创建了多个基于同一数据源但布局不同的数据透视表时,如果不共享缓存,每个透视表都会生成一个独立的缓存副本,这将使文件体积成倍增加。确保新创建的数据透视表使用现有缓存,可以避免这种不必要的膨胀。

六、 嵌入对象的体积负担

       这是导致文件体积激增的最常见原因之一。为了丰富报告内容,用户常常会在电子表格中插入各种对象,例如高分辨率的图片、公司标志、复杂的图表、矢量图形,甚至是其他文件的嵌入对象(如文档、演示文稿)或控件。一张未经压缩的几兆字节的图片,插入后就会直接将等量体积加到文件上。如果插入了多张此类图片或大型图表对象,文件大小轻松突破百兆也就不足为奇了。

七、 隐藏数据与命名区域

       一些不易察觉的数据也会占用空间。例如,隐藏的行、列或工作表,其中的数据依然被完整保存。此外,为单元格区域定义的“名称”(命名区域)虽然方便了公式引用,但每个名称及其引用位置的信息都需要存储。在一个经过长期迭代、维护不善的文件中,可能积累了大量不再使用的、无效的或引用范围过大的命名区域,这些都会默默增加文件的负担。

八、 宏代码的存储与历史遗留

       如果工作簿中包含了宏功能,那么用于实现自动化任务的代码会以可视基本脚本的形式存储在工作簿内部。大量的、复杂的宏代码模块本身会占用空间。此外,在编辑宏的过程中,程序可能会保留一些历史信息或调试信息。虽然这部分通常占比不大,但在极端情况下,尤其是对于历史悠久的、经过多人编辑的自动化模板文件,积累的冗余代码信息也可能成为文件增大的因素之一。

九、 外部链接与查询的缓存

       当电子表格中包含指向其他工作簿、数据库或网络数据源的外部链接时,为了方便离线查看或提高性能,程序有时会缓存所获取数据的一部分或全部。这种数据缓存会被保存在当前文件中。如果通过“获取和转换数据”功能(前身为“Power Query”)导入了大量的外部数据,并且设置了将数据本身保留在工作簿中的选项,那么导入的原始数据或中间查询结果都可能被完整地嵌入到文件里,造成体积庞大。

十、 版本兼容性与冗余信息

       为了确保文件在不同版本的程序之间能够正确打开和显示,尤其是为了向后兼容旧版本,文件格式中有时会包含一些冗余的兼容性信息。当您使用高版本程序编辑一个可能需要在低版本中打开的文件时,或者文件经过多个不同版本程序的反复保存后,可能会积累一些这样的信息。虽然这不是主要因素,但在一个已经因其他原因变得很大的文件中,它可能起到“雪上加霜”的作用。

十一、 文件损坏与结构异常

       在极少数情况下,文件体积异常增大可能是由于文件结构在保存或传输过程中出现轻微损坏或异常所致。例如,程序内部用于管理单元格、样式等资源的“索引”或“表”可能出现错误,导致分配了远超实际需要的存储空间,或者某些本应被清理的临时数据未被正确释放。这类问题通常表现为文件体积与其中可见内容的数量严重不符,且常规的清理操作效果有限。

十二、 数据模型与高级分析功能

       在较新的版本中,电子表格程序集成了更强大的数据分析功能,如“数据模型”。数据模型允许用户整合多个表的数据并建立关系,类似于在文件内部创建了一个小型的分析数据库。当您将大量数据添加到数据模型中,并使用数据透视表或分析表达式基于此模型进行分析时,这些数据同样会被存储在工作簿内部。与普通工作表数据相比,数据模型可能以不同的压缩格式存储,但海量的基础数据依然是构成文件体积的主体。

诊断与优化策略

       面对一个107兆字节的巨大文件,您可以按照以下步骤进行诊断和优化:首先,尝试将文件另存为“XLSX”格式。其次,检查并清除所有工作表中实际使用范围之外的格式和内容。接着,审查并简化复杂的公式,避免整列引用和过多易失性函数。然后,检查所有嵌入对象,对图片进行压缩或考虑使用链接而非嵌入。之后,合并数据透视表的缓存,清理未使用的命名区域和隐藏数据。最后,对于由外部数据查询或数据模型导致的大文件,评估是否可以将数据源与报告文件分离,仅将必要的汇总结果放入报告。

预防胜于治疗

       养成良好的文件使用习惯,可以有效避免文件无谓膨胀。始终有意识地将数据和格式限制在必要的范围内;对于大型静态数据集,考虑使用数据库进行存储,电子表格仅作为分析和展示前端;定期对重要模板文件进行“健康检查”和清理。理解电子表格文件体积背后的逻辑,不仅能帮助您解决眼前的“臃肿”问题,更能让您在未来的工作中更加游刃有余,充分发挥这款工具的效率潜能。

       总而言之,一个体积巨大的电子表格文件往往是多种设计选择和使用习惯共同作用的结果。从格式到内容,从可见数据到后台缓存,每一个环节都可能成为“增重”的推手。通过系统性的分析和有针对性的优化,完全有可能让文件“瘦身”成功,恢复其应有的轻盈与敏捷。

相关文章
静电怎么测量
静电测量是工业生产和科学研究中的关键技术。本文系统阐述了测量静电的十二个核心方面,包括静电场强计、表面电位计、电荷量表等关键仪器的原理与使用方法,深入分析了接触式与非接触式测量的区别,并结合实际场景如电子制造、石油化工等,详细说明了测量规范、数据解读与安全防护措施,旨在为从业人员提供一套全面、专业且可操作性强的静电测量实践指南。
2026-04-26 09:24:46
301人看过
什么是bro测试
Bro测试是一种评估男性友谊关系质量与深度的非标准化评估框架,它源自西方青年文化,通过一系列行为观察、互动模式和价值观契合度的隐性指标,来衡量朋友之间信任、忠诚与默契的程度。这种测试并非学术概念,而是流行于社交实践中的关系检验方法,常涉及共同经历、危机应对和日常支持等情境。
2026-04-26 09:24:27
386人看过
如何测试电流 电压
电流与电压是电路中最基础且关键的物理量,准确测试它们对于电气安全、设备调试与故障诊断至关重要。本文将系统阐述测试的基本原理,详细介绍数字万用表、钳形表等主流工具的使用方法与安全规范,涵盖从直流到交流、从弱电到强电等多种场景的实测步骤与数据分析技巧,旨在为读者提供一套完整、专业且安全的实践指南。
2026-04-26 09:24:23
261人看过
word设置图形层图片什么意思
本文将深入解析在文字处理软件中“设置图形层”这一核心功能的具体含义及其在图片处理中的应用。通过剖析图层概念、操作逻辑与实际应用场景,系统阐述该功能如何实现对文档内图片元素的精准控制与灵活排版。文章旨在为用户提供从基础认知到高级技巧的完整知识体系,助力提升文档编辑的效率与专业性。
2026-04-26 09:24:12
55人看过
led灯珠怎么拆
拆卸发光二极管灯珠是一项融合了细致耐心与专业技巧的工作,无论您是希望修复一盏故障的台灯,还是计划升级家中的照明模块。本文将为您提供一份从安全准备到实操完成的完整指南。内容涵盖必要的工具选择、不同封装形式灯珠的拆卸原理与方法、热风枪等专业设备的安全使用要诀,以及在拆卸后如何进行电路板焊盘的有效清理与检查,旨在帮助您安全、高效地完成操作,避免损坏昂贵的发光二极管组件或底层电路板。
2026-04-26 09:24:10
372人看过
如何确定谐振点
谐振点的确定是电子工程、声学及机械系统设计与调试中的核心环节,它直接关系到系统的效率、稳定性与性能表现。本文将系统性地阐述谐振点的基本概念、理论依据,并详细解析在电路、声学及机械振动等不同领域中确定谐振点的多种实用方法与技术手段,旨在为工程师、科研人员及爱好者提供一套清晰、可操作的深度指南。
2026-04-26 09:23:52
305人看过